Lounge Access: Your Oasis in the Airport Hustle
One of the most coveted perks for travelers is airport lounge access. These lounges offer comfort, food, drinks, Wi-Fi, and a peaceful environment away from crowded terminals.
Popular lounge access programs:
-
Priority Pass: Accepted at 1,300+ lounges worldwide, many premium cards offer free or discounted Priority Pass membership (e.g., Chase Sapphire Reserve®, Amex Platinum®).
-
American Express Centurion Lounges: Exclusive to Amex Platinum and Centurion cardholders.
-
Delta Sky Club, United Club, or other airline-specific lounges: Access granted through certain airline co-branded credit cards.

Insurance Protections: Safety Nets That Save You Money
Premium cards often provide robust insurance coverage that can substitute for buying costly third-party policies.
Key insurance benefits include:
-
Trip Cancellation/Interruption Insurance: Reimburses non-refundable travel expenses if your trip is canceled for covered reasons.
-
Primary Rental Car Insurance: Covers damage or theft without needing to file a claim with your personal auto insurer. Cards like Chase Sapphire Reserve® and Amex Platinum® offer this.
-
Travel Accident Insurance: Offers financial protection in case of accidents during travel.
-
Baggage Delay/Loss Insurance: Reimburses essentials if your bags are delayed or lost.
-
Purchase Protection & Extended Warranty: Protects new purchases against theft or damage and extends the manufacturer’s warranty.
Concierge Services: Your Personal Assistant, 24/7
Some high-tier cards come with concierge services, a personal assistant available via phone or app to help with:
-
Booking flights and hotels
-
Securing restaurant reservations
-
Finding hard-to-get event tickets
-
Planning unique experiences
-
Gift shopping and delivery
This service, often included with Amex Platinum, Citi Prestige, and other premium cards, can save hours and reduce stress.
Other Hidden Perks Worth Knowing
-
Global Entry/TSA PreCheck Fee Credit: Many cards reimburse the application fee for expedited security programs.
-
No Foreign Transaction Fees: Essential for international travelers to avoid extra charges on purchases abroad.
-
Cell Phone Insurance: Covers theft or damage to your phone when you pay the bill with the card.
-
Exclusive Event Access: Invitations to concerts, sporting events, and private experiences.
-
Annual Travel Credits: Statement credits for travel-related expenses, such as airline fees or Uber rides.
How to Unlock These Benefits
-
Read your card’s benefits guide: Many perks are buried deep in the fine print or issuer’s website.
-
Enroll when required: Some perks require active enrollment (e.g., Priority Pass).
-
Use your card to pay for eligible services: Insurance and fee credits often require payment through the card.
-
Keep records and receipts: In case you need to file claims for insurance or reimbursements.
